Ballybay, which means mouth of the ford birch in Irish language, is a beautiful town located in the county of Monaghan in Ireland. The town is located on the meeting point of different roads leading to town such as Monaghan, Castleblayney, Clones, and Carrickmacrossand. The town is situated on the bank of a large lake called Lough Major and the smaller Lough Minor. The town is covered with lush green vegetation and has beautiful landscapes. Owing to its charming beauty, travellers prefer to come here for self catering holidays. The town is dotted with old buildings and cottages, where travellers can stay and delight of self catering. As it is a main town of the county, it is dotted with several attractions located in and around the town, of which the most popular ones Wildlife & Heritage Centre, Armagh planetarium, old Mellifont Abbey, St. Peter’s church, Bachelors Lodge Equestrian Centre, and County Museum. Besides the attractions, there are trails and tracks besides rivers, where tourists can take stroll.
